Does it snow in London every year

Does it snow in London every year?

snowfall is rare in London and it doesn’t snow every year, but it will snow if there is enough moisture in the air. Most of the time, a light dusting of snow is all you’ll get. If you absolutely want to see snow in London, you can head to Winter Wonderland near Hyde Park, or to the South of England to see the white stuff!

Does it snow on average in London UK?

There are different ways to look at this question, so we will look at the most common ways people have looked at it in the past. Most people cite the average annual snowfall in London is about 12 inches, which is not that much at all. In fact, most of the snow falls in the capital is usually gone within a day or two. However, snowstorms can still happen, sometimes lasting for more than a week! When this happens, there can be up to eight inches of snow on

Does it snow in London UK in December?

December snowfall is quite rare in the capital. There are many people who have never seen snowfall in December. If you are planning to travel to the city and want to know if it snows in December, you can check the weather forecast. It is not impossible that you will see snow in December. But it is more likely that you will not.

Does it snow in London UK in November?

Snowfall in the UK is possible in November, but it’s rarer than snow in other months. A dusting of snow is more likely to fall in November, but snowstorms are more likely in December. However, snow rarely falls during the month of November.

Does it snow in London UK every year?

Yes, snow does definitely fall in London, usually during the winter months, although it rarely snows more than a few centimetres at a time. The last time snowfall was recorded in December was in 1982. Snow is not unheard of in October either, although it does usually only fall in very rare and light snowfalls.